You will be updated with latest job alerts via emailAt Williams Racing were building the next chapter of our story. Its powered by smart technology bold innovation and incredible people.
Were on the lookout for a Senior Simulation Development Engineer whos passionate about vehicle dynamics thrives on solving complex problems and wants to help shape the tools that drive our Formula 1 car forward.
This role is about more than writing code - its about creating the simulations and models that underpin everything we do on track. Youll lead the development of our in-house vehicle model library ensuring our tools are accurate efficient and easy to use across the team. Youll also design and evolve simulation tools that help us understand and optimise performance including lap time simulations and ride dynamics. Your work will directly influence our design and development decisions helping us to push performance boundaries on and off the track.
Were looking for someone with a strong technical foundation - ideally a degree in Mathematics Engineering or a related field - and experience in object-oriented modelling (such as Modelica) and coding in C/C. Youll be someone who can combine their knowledge of numerical algorithms and optimisation techniques with their experience developing models of physical systems to solve complex engineering problems.
Youll also be familiar with standards like FMI/FMU and have a solid understanding of vehicle dynamics numerical methods and algorithm development. Experience with Python MATLAB/Simulink or cross-platform development is a bonus.
